The Board of Directors of Alamos Gold (AGI) has declared a quarterly dividend of US$0.025 per common share.

The company has paid dividends for 13 consecutive years, during which time $264 million has been returned to shareholders through dividends and share buybacks, including $27 million thus far in 2022.

This includes one million shares repurchased under the normal course issuer bid in May 2022 for $7.4 million, or $7.42 per share.

The dividend is payable on June 30, 2022, to shareholders of record as of the close of business on June 16, 2022. This dividend qualifies as an “eligible dividend” for Canadian income tax purposes.

Alamos Gold has implemented a dividend reinvestment plan (DRIP). This gives shareholders the option of increasing their investment in Alamos at a discount to the prevailing market price and without incurring any transaction costs by choosing to receive common shares in place of cash dividends.

For shareholders that choose to participate in the DRIP, common shares will be issued from treasury at a 2 per cent discount to the prevailing market price. Participating in the DRIP is not mandatory.

To qualify for the June 30, 2022 dividend, enrollment must be completed by 4:00 pm EST on the fifth business day before the June 16, 2022 dividend record date.

Alamos is a Canadian-based intermediate gold producer with diversified production from three operating mines in North America.
